    @jean-philippedoyon9904 หลายเดือนก่อน +42

    For the little story...DC run a poll in 1988 with the fan to decide if Jason Todd would be killed or saved...The fans voted to killed him and only 72 votes made the difference, which lead to a Death in the Family story. Jason Todd was very divisive in the fandom, being from different background and being less emphatic than Dick Grayson. Some says, if they did the poll again, he would have survive today, in 1988 the DC phone line was filled with angry fan of the decision...Do you think they did right ?

    I have few complaints about this movie, but one definite one is how they toned down what made Bruce upset at Jason. He didn't break some guy's collarbone - in the comic Jason as Robin is implied to have shoved a serial rapist off a building to his death because he had attacked a girl Jason knew, and that girl ended herself over it. Jason says the guy saw him and slipped in a panic, but Bruce isn't sure he believes him, but isn't sure he wants to know the truth either.

    @jamesbunt6846 23 วันที่ผ่านมา +2

    Jason Todd was the regular Robin twice before being killed. Originally he was a carbon copy of Dick, right down to being an acrobat, but then Crisis on Infinite Earths happened, which was a line wide reboot of the DC Universe. The plan was to update/refresh/streamline the comic line and make it easier to jump into, but Batman was doing just fine before the reboot, so there wasn't much of a need for a major shake up. Rather than keeping him as a copy of Dick, they went the opposite way and he was the son of a criminal killed by Two-Face left fending for himself (which is why he was needing to steal tires to get by).
    One of his best stories is trying to save a woman from an abuser who has diplomatic immunity (they loved that in the 80s), after catching him red handed and arrested, the abuser is freed and makes a call to the victim, by the time they get to her, she has already killed herself. This is where the seeds of the Red Hood is planted, we see Robin surprising the abuser on his balcony, then we see the guy falling to his death. Gordon says something like that Robin said "he was surprised and fell, I don't know if I believe him". I vote for that he chucked him off the building, but within the issue it is not certain.
    Death in the Family is the story with the call in gimmick, they had two endings worked out, one where Batman is exclaiming that lives and the one that one the poll which is very close to what is shown here. The biggest change is that Jason had gone to find his previously unknown biological mother, and she sold him out to the Joker. After the beating, and being unable to disarm the bomb, he used his body to shield his "mother". Controversially the poll was likely rigged by a fan who used an autodialer to vote every few minutes (the editor says there isn't proof, but that he heard that it happened), the vote was 5,343 votes for Jason's death over 5,271 for his survival-a margin of just 72 votes.
    As a fan at the time it was a great story, and terrible aftermath, and it was years of angry sad Batman stories, basically until a very young Tim Drake showed up having figured out Batman's secret identity and became the the Robin.

    @ryanallen5396 22 วันที่ผ่านมา +2

    the thing is, that Jason doesn't know, is that, in the comics, Bruce did go after the Joker after Jason's death. Two things stopped him from killing the clown. One was the fact that the Joker had somehow managed to become the Iranian ambassador to the UN, thus granting him diplomatic immunity. Bruce, however, doesn't care about starting an international incident, so he goes after the Joker anyway. Superman has to step in and tell Bruce that if he starts an international incident, the UN is gonna order him after Bruce. Bruce backs off, but warns Clark that WHEN the Joker steps out of line, he'll come for him. Joker, of course, steps out of line, Bruce comes after him, and comes very close to beating him to death, but Clark stops him, because he knows that Bruce would never forgive himself if he killed.
